Crafting Your Quick & Flavorful Weeknight Black Bean Chili: Essential Ingredients
The beauty of this weeknight black bean chili recipe lies in its straightforward yet potent ingredient list. Each component plays a crucial role in building a flavorful, hearty dish in record time.
The Core Ingredients
- Bacon (or Olive Oil): Starting with diced bacon adds an incredible depth of smoky, savory flavor to the chili, and its rendered fat provides the perfect base for sautéing. If you prefer a leaner option, a tablespoon of olive oil works wonderfully to achieve the same sautéing effect without the bacon's richness.
- Onion & Garlic: The aromatic foundation of almost any great chili. Diced onion and chopped garlic release their sweet and pungent flavors as they soften, creating a fragrant base that permeates the entire dish.
- Lean Ground Beef: Opting for lean ground beef (90/10 or higher) is a game-changer for a quick chili. It means less fat to drain, preserving all the delicious flavors that develop in your pot. For those looking for alternatives, ground turkey or a plant-based crumble can be easily substituted.
- Crushed Tomatoes: These are the backbone of the chili's body and tangy flavor. Their consistency is perfect for a hearty, thick chili, eliminating the need for extensive simmering to break down whole tomatoes.
- Black Beans: A powerhouse of protein and fiber, black beans add substantial texture and nutritional value. Remember to drain and rinse them thoroughly before adding them to your pot to reduce excess sodium and improve the chili's overall taste.
Flavor Boosters & Seasonings
- Worcestershire Sauce (or Coconut Aminos): A secret weapon for adding a profound umami kick and a touch of tanginess that deepens the chili's flavor profile. Coconut Aminos offer a gluten-free and soy-free alternative with a similar savory impact.
- Classic Chili Seasonings:
- Chili Powder: The star spice, providing that quintessential chili warmth and flavor.
- Ground Cumin: Adds an earthy, robust note that is essential to black bean chili.
- Dried Oregano: Contributes a subtle, aromatic herbal quality that rounds out the spice blend.
Feel free to adjust the amounts of these seasonings to suit your personal preference for spice and intensity. Your Step-by-Step Guide to a Perfect 30-Minute Weeknight Black Bean Chili
Preparing this easy black bean chili is incredibly straightforward. Follow these simple steps to go from zero to a delicious, hot meal in no time:
Prepping for Success
- Gather Your Ingredients: Have everything measured, diced, and ready to go. This "mise en place" approach is key to keeping the cooking process quick and seamless.
- Rinse Your Beans: Don't forget to drain and rinse your canned black beans thoroughly. This washes away extra sodium and ensures a cleaner flavor.
Cooking Instructions
- Sauté the Foundation: In a large, heavy-bottomed stock pot or Dutch oven, cook the diced bacon over medium heat until crispy. Remove the bacon with a slotted spoon to a paper towel-lined plate, reserving the drippings in the pot. If using olive oil, add it to the hot pot.
- Aromatics First: Add the diced onion to the pot with the bacon drippings (or olive oil). Cook until softened and translucent, about 3-5 minutes. Stir in the chopped garlic and cook for another minute until fragrant, being careful not to burn it.
- Brown the Beef: Add the lean ground beef to the pot. Break it up with a spoon and cook until it's no longer pink, about 5-7 minutes. Since you're using lean beef, you likely won't need to drain any fat, preserving all the delicious browned bits at the bottom of the pot.
- Season & Stir: Stir in the chili powder, ground cumin, and dried oregano. Cook for about 1 minute, stirring constantly, to toast the spices and release their aromas.
- Combine & Simmer: Pour in the crushed tomatoes, black beans, and Worcestershire sauce (or Coconut Aminos). Stir everything together well. Bring the mixture to a gentle simmer, then reduce the heat to low, cover, and let it cook for about 20 minutes. This short simmer allows the flavors to meld beautifully without needing an all-day commitment.
- Serve & Enjoy: Ladle the hot chili into bowls. Now comes the best part – customize it with your favorite toppings!

Must-Have Toppings:
- Creamy Delights: A dollop of sour cream or Greek yogurt adds a cooling, tangy contrast to the rich chili.
- Cheesy Goodness: Shredded cheddar, Monterey Jack, or a spicy pepper jack melt beautifully over the hot chili.
- Freshness Factor: Chopped fresh cilantro, sliced green onions, or diced avocado bring vibrant color and a burst of fresh flavor.
- Spicy Kick: Sliced jalapeños (fresh or pickled) or a dash of your favorite hot sauce will satisfy heat seekers.
- Crunch & Texture: Crumbled corn chips, tortilla strips, or the crispy bacon you cooked earlier provide a delightful crunch.
Serving Ideas Beyond the Bowl:
- Classic Pairing: Serve alongside warm, buttery cornbread or crunchy tortilla chips for dipping.
- Chili Dogs & Burgers: Ladle this chili over hot dogs or use it as a hearty topping for your favorite burgers.
- Baked Potato Bar: Create a fun meal by offering large baked potatoes as a base, then let everyone load up with chili and their preferred toppings.
- Chili Rice Bowls: Serve over a bed of fluffy white or brown rice for an even more substantial and satisfying meal.
- Nachos Supreme: Transform your leftover chili into epic nachos by layering it over tortilla chips with plenty of cheese and your favorite fixings.

- Make It Your Own: Don't be afraid to experiment with other vegetables. Diced bell peppers or corn can be added along with the onions for extra flavor and nutrients. For a touch of smoky heat, a can of fire-roasted diced tomatoes can elevate the flavor even further.
- Spice Level Adjustment: If you like more heat, add a pinch of cayenne pepper or a chopped jalapeño (seeds removed for less heat, left in for more) when sautéing the aromatics. For a milder chili, stick to the classic chili powder.
- Vegetarian Option: To make this recipe vegetarian, simply omit the bacon and ground beef. Sauté the aromatics in olive oil, then add a can of drained and rinsed pinto beans along with the black beans and a cup of vegetable broth to maintain consistency. You can also add chopped mushrooms or a plant-based ground crumble for extra heartiness.
- Batch Cooking & Storage: This chili makes fantastic leftovers! Allow it to cool completely before transferring it to an airtight container. It will keep well in the refrigerator for up to 5 days, making it perfect for meal prepping your lunches or quick dinners throughout the week.
- Freezer-Friendly: Chili freezes beautifully. Portion cooled chili into freezer-safe containers or bags and store for up to 3 months. Thaw overnight in the refrigerator and reheat gently on the stove or in the microwave. This is a brilliant way to always have a homemade, hearty meal ready when you're in a pinch.
